Use a gentle cleanser to wash dirt, oil, sweat, or makeup. Cleansing helps other products reach your skin instead of resting on top.

If you use toner or a hydrating mist, apply it when your skin is damp. It removes leftover residue and helps balance your skin’s pH. Use alcohol-free formulas if you have sensitive or dry skin.

Apply light-weight, active treatments next. Serums with ingredients like vitamin C, hyaluronic acid, or retinol go here. Do spot treatments (for acne etc.) after serums if needed.

Moisturizer helps trap moisture and protect the skin barrier. Even oily skin benefits from moisturizer (choose lighter or gel-based).

If your routine includes a face oil, apply it after moisturizer (in most cases), so it locks in the hydration. Sunscreen Sunscreen is the final step in the morning. Nothing should go on top of it. Use broad-spectrum sunscreen with at least SPF 30.
